Components

  • Standard: OpenTelemetry (traces, metrics, logs)
  • Traces: Distributed tracing with correlation IDs
  • Metrics: RED metrics (Rate, Errors, Duration) for all services
  • Logs: Structured JSON logging with trace context

Constraints

  • All HTTP/gRPC endpoints must emit latency and error metrics
  • All cross-service calls must propagate trace context
  • Logs must be structured JSON with correlation IDs
  • No console.log / print for operational logging

When to use

Any project with backend services, APIs, or distributed systems. Essential for production debugging, performance monitoring, and incident response.

Requirements (Frame activity)

  • All services must define SLOs for availability and latency
  • Incident response requires structured logs and traces

Design

  • Use OpenTelemetry SDK for instrumentation (not vendor-specific SDKs)
  • All cross-service calls propagate W3C Trace Context headers
  • Define span naming conventions per service type
  • Metric names follow OpenTelemetry semantic conventions

Implementation

  • Structured JSON logging — no unstructured text logs in production
  • Every HTTP handler: request ID, trace ID, duration, status code
  • Every database query: duration, table, operation type
  • Every external API call: duration, endpoint, status code
  • Error logs include stack trace and request context
  • Use log levels consistently: ERROR (actionable), WARN (degraded), INFO (business events), DEBUG (development only)

Testing

  • Verify trace propagation in integration tests
  • Verify structured log format in unit tests
  • Load test with tracing enabled to validate overhead < 5%
  • Alert on missing trace context in production logs

Deployment

  • Configure OTEL collector as a sidecar or daemonset
  • Export to the project’s observability backend (Grafana, Datadog, etc.)
  • Set sampling rate appropriate to traffic volume
